Cruising around the boards, I saw this post, and, depending on how desperate you are. You can save all 1,000 items


Several people have offereed the free use of their lots on Gorath, so hopefully you can get 10 nice, shiny, empty lots. Then, no need to go to Naboo. Buy factories. 10 of them(no structure factories) Put a weeks' worth of maintance in each. then, put 100 items in each of the input hoppers. Problem solved. 100 x 10 lots = 1000 items. It will be quite expensive to purchase and pay maintenace on those 10 factories, but not much more than 10 heavies would be , and I maintain 10 heavies myself each week.


It's a solution probably many people haven't thought of because of the sheer expense of it, but if you REALLY need storage space...
